You can only get help paying for care that is outside school hours, for example after school clubs or breakfast clubs. You cannot get help paying for: 1. your child’s compulsory education 2. private lessons during school time (for example, private music lessons during school hours) See more Childcare provided by a foster carer in England only counts if they’re registered as a childcare provider.
